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2307 54575108874 089
853 5709 9955
853 5709 9955
304098 24 087303062
All about undefined
Interested in learning more?
853 5709 9955
304098 24 087303062
See more
16 501
57 56 1218 123688733
See more
933178 30 60639474938
1080 16958 517671704 06763019
See more